- #include "qemu-common.h"
- #include "sysemu/char.h"
- #define BUF_SIZE 32
- typedef struct {
- CharDriverState *chr;
- uint8_t in_buf[32];
- int in_buf_used;
- } TestdevCharState;
- /* Try to interpret a whole incoming packet */
- static int testdev_eat_packet(TestdevCharState *testdev)
- {
- const uint8_t *cur = testdev->in_buf;
- int len = testdev->in_buf_used;
- uint8_t c;
- int arg;
- #define EAT(c) do { \
- if (!len--) { \
- return 0; \
- } \
- c = *cur++; \
- } while (0)
- EAT(c);
- while (isspace(c)) {
- EAT(c);
- }
- arg = 0;
- while (isdigit(c)) {
- arg = arg * 10 + c - '0';
- EAT(c);
- }
- while (isspace(c)) {
- EAT(c);
- }
- switch (c) {
- case 'q':
- exit((arg << 1) | 1);
- break;
- default:
- break;
- }
- return cur - testdev->in_buf;
- }
- /* The other end is writing some data. Store it and try to interpret */
- static int testdev_write(CharDriverState *chr, const uint8_t *buf, int len)
- {
- TestdevCharState *testdev = chr->opaque;
- int tocopy, eaten, orig_len = len;
- while (len) {
- /* Complete our buffer as much as possible */
- tocopy = MIN(len, BUF_SIZE - testdev->in_buf_used);
- memcpy(testdev->in_buf + testdev->in_buf_used, buf, tocopy);
- testdev->in_buf_used += tocopy;
- buf += tocopy;
- len -= tocopy;
- /* Interpret it as much as possible */
- while (testdev->in_buf_used > 0 &&
- (eaten = testdev_eat_packet(testdev)) > 0) {
- memmove(testdev->in_buf, testdev->in_buf + eaten,
- testdev->in_buf_used - eaten);
- testdev->in_buf_used -= eaten;
- }
- }
- return orig_len;
- }
- static void testdev_close(struct CharDriverState *chr)
- {
- TestdevCharState *testdev = chr->opaque;
- g_free(testdev);
- }
- CharDriverState *chr_testdev_init(void)
- {
- TestdevCharState *testdev;
- CharDriverState *chr;
- testdev = g_malloc0(sizeof(TestdevCharState));
- testdev->chr = chr = g_malloc0(sizeof(CharDriverState));
- chr->opaque = testdev;
- chr->chr_write = testdev_write;
- chr->chr_close = testdev_close;
- return chr;
- }
- static void register_types(void)
- {
- register_char_driver("testdev", CHARDEV_BACKEND_KIND_TESTDEV, NULL);
- }
- type_init(register_types);
